How to Find Cancer Lawyers Near You1. Research and Referrals
Start by gathering suggestions from trusted sources. Friends, household, or colleagues who have actually gone through similar experiences can offer important insights. Additionally, online platforms, like Yelp or Avvo, offer evaluations and rankings for attorneys in your location.
2. Use Online Search Tools
Sites such as FindLaw and Justia permit you to search for attorneys by specialty and area. Use keywords such as "Successful Railroad Cancer Lawsuit Settlements lawyer near me" or "poisonous direct exposure attorney" to narrow down your results.
3. Check State Bar Associations
Each state has a Bar Association that keeps a directory site of certified lawyers. Evaluating this can help guarantee the lawyer remains in excellent standing and has the proper certifications.
4. Schedule Initial Consultations
Many lawyers use totally free consultations. Use this opportunity to determine their experience, understanding of your case, and whether you feel comfy working with them.

Cancer lawyers primarily handle malpractice cases, harmful direct exposure claims, item liability, work environment direct exposure cases, and hereditary predisposition cases.
How much does it cost to hire a cancer lawyer?
Many cancer lawyers work on a contingency cost basis, suggesting they just earn money if you win your case. Typically, their fees are a portion of the awarded amount.
For how long do I have to file a cancer lawsuit?
The time restricts to submit a lawsuit, known as statutes of restrictions, differ by state and the kind of claim. Consulting with a lawyer as soon as possible is necessary to guarantee you fulfill all due dates.
What compensation can I get out of a cancer lawsuit?
Possible damages might consist of comp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and in some cases, compensatory damages versus the accountable party.
